Which visa types are most common for growth product manager roles in New York?
The H-1B visa is the most common visa category for growth product managers in New York, as the role typically requires a bachelor's degree or higher in a relevant field such as computer science, engineering, or business. Candidates from Australia may qualify for the E-3 visa, and Canadian and Mexican nationals can explore the TN visa under the management consultant or computer systems analyst categories, depending on role scope. O-1A is another pathway for candidates with a strong track record of recognition in their field.

Which cities in New York have the most growth product manager sponsorship jobs?
New York City accounts for the overwhelming majority of growth product manager sponsorship opportunities in the state, concentrated in Manhattan neighborhoods like Midtown, the Flatiron District, and Hudson Yards. Brooklyn's tech corridor in DUMBO also has a presence, particularly among consumer-focused startups. Outside the city, opportunities are limited, though some employers in Albany and Buffalo have product roles tied to government technology or healthcare-adjacent platforms.
Are there any New York-specific considerations for growth product manager sponsorship candidates?
New York's high cost of living means the Department of Labor's prevailing wage determinations for growth product manager roles in the New York metropolitan area are among the highest in the country, which employers must meet when filing a Labor Condition Application for H-1B sponsorship. New York City is also home to several universities with strong product management pipelines, including NYU and Columbia, meaning OPT candidates are a familiar profile for many local employers.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ored growth product manager jobs in New York?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
